How to structure interval progression for swimmers transitioning into open water competition with speed and control focus.
A practical, phased approach helps pool swimmers adapt to open water by balancing speed work with neutral buoyancy, sighting discipline, and consistent pacing, ensuring confidence and race-day control.

Swimmers transitioning from pool to open water face a shift in conditions that demands a deliberate interval progression. The first phase centers on maintaining swimming mechanics under variable currents and chop, while preserving tempo and efficiency. Start with longer, steady efforts that emphasize stroke length and breath control, then gradually introduce moderate-speed intervals that mimic race pace. Focus on consistent splits and minimal lap-to-lap variance. Include a few easy swims between harder sets to promote active recovery. By building a foundation of stable form before emphasizing speed, athletes reduce the risk of compounding technique flaws as water temperature, visibility, and distance introduce new challenges.
As confidence grows, introduce mixed-quality sets that blend speed with control. Utilize distance-based intervals such as 200s and 300s at a controlled tempo, interspersed with 50s or 100s at a higher tempo. The goal is to train the body to sustain faster speeds without sacrificing technique, breathing rhythm, or body position. In open water, sighting and navigation play a bigger role, so integrate sets that require brief head lifts between strokes or gentle pauses to reestablish balance. Keep sessions varied but focused, ensuring swimmers finish with a feeling of readiness rather than fatigue or confusion about how to transition from pool pace to open-water cadence.
Pace-shaping cycles with balance, breath, and navigation in mind.
A successful interval progression starts with a defensible base: sustainable technique at a gentle pace that translates to open water. Concentrate on a relaxed head position, shoulder mechanics, and a neutral kick, resisting the urge to chase speed too early. The first cycles emphasize consistency over intensity. Gradually add 5–10 percent more pace across sets as your timing and breathing feel natural. Include brief, controlled sighting drills within the intervals—lift the head just enough to spot buoys or landmarks, then resume streamlining to avoid disruptive wiggles. This approach nurtures confidence while preserving efficient mechanics under more challenging environmental conditions.

Once technique is stable, escalate to tempo-focused intervals designed to improve alacrity without unravelling form. Use sets like 6×100 at a controlled speed, followed by 4×50 at a faster pace, ensuring adequate rest between efforts. The key is to keep the rest generous enough to maintain quality, yet short enough to demand purposeful pace preservation. During these phases, practice breathing pattern discipline and torso alignment, since turbulent water can distort rhythm. Record splits to monitor consistency across repetitions, and keep a training diary noting perceptions of balance, sighting ease, and how smoothly you resume a steady cadence after each head lift.
Focused drills link technique, speed, and navigational steadiness.
In the mid-phase, begin incorporating open-water simulations that approximate race day realities. Choose coastline or lake environments with mild chop and air movement, and structure sets around 400s and 600s at a steady but assertive pace. Between these, insert 100s at a higher speed that still prioritizes technique. The aim is to teach the body to tolerate slight discomfort without sacrificing form, a crucial skill in longer swims with variable conditions. Emphasize controlled breathing, even if wake and spray complicate inhalation. A cooperative mindset—staying relaxed yet determined—helps swimmers maintain composure when currents push from the side or when distance feels extended.

Navigation and sighting drills deserve deliberate integration. For example, within longer intervals, insert short sighting breaks to pick a landmark and then return to a streamlined tempo. This practice reduces hesitation and unnecessary zigzagging, particularly when waves demand micro-adjustments. Pair these drills with mental cues: a soft exhale at release, a deliberate inhale at the point of sighting, and a quick reset to resume a smooth glide. Over weeks, the swimmer’s ability to reestablish rhythm after a brief interruption improves markedly, translating to faster times and more precise course tracking on race day.
Real-world sessions test technique, tempo, and composure together.
As you approach peak conditioning, structure sessions that mimic the most demanding moments of the open-water race. Implement two to three sets of 300s or 500s at moderate-to-fast pace with ample rest to preserve form. Interject 50s at a strong tempo to sharpen turnover while maintaining breathing discipline. The practice reaffirms efficient stroke mechanics under fatigue and teaches the swimmer to distribute effort evenly across the distance. Visualization can accompany these sessions: imagine steady waves, clear sightlines, and a consistent breathing pattern. Such mental rehearsal reinforces physical tendencies and fosters a more resilient, race-ready mindset.
Integrate transition-focused practice to bridge pool familiarity with open-water realities. Dedicate portions of workouts to moving from push-off into a connected, gliding phase, with just enough breath control to avoid early fatigue. Blend stainless-steel tempo intervals with buoy turns or simulated course changes, ensuring the body learns how to recover balance instantly after a startled or gusty moment. The objective is to prevent stumbles in actual races, where panic or haste can derail rhythm. Through deliberate repetition, swimmers internalize a smoother, more efficient response to any disturbance they encounter in open water.

Holistic preparation blends fitness, technique, and strategy.
Training for speed in open water demands specificity, so tailor sets to reflect common course layouts. If the triathlon venue features long stretches between buoys, emphasize sustained tempo and even pacing. Include longer aerobic efforts at 70–80 percent threshold with occasional surges to 85 percent to build tolerance for variable tides. Focus on maintaining neuromuscular coordination—arm recovery, shoulder stability, and hip rotation—while the water environment challenges breath timing. Regularly assess your ability to maintain form during these extended efforts, noting any creeping decline in efficiency. Addressing these tendencies early prevents a drop in performance on race day.
Safety and comfort deserve equal weight in interval progression. Always start with a warm-up that primes the shoulders and core, then progressively intensify while respecting personal limits. Stay mindful of water temperature, visibility, and swim neighbors; practice clear sighting protocols and keep a steady, predictable path to reduce potential collisions. Hydration and fueling strategies should align with training volume, ensuring energy sustains longer sessions without compromising technique. After intense sets, perform a thorough cool-down to promote recovery, focusing on loosening the shoulders, glutes, and calves. By caring for the body holistically, you sustain progress across weeks of open-water preparation.
A well-structured progression integrates performance metrics with individualized pacing plans. Start with a baseline assessment, noting stroke rate, distance-per-stroke, and heart-rate responses during controlled pool swims. Use these metrics to calibrate interval lengths, rest intervals, and tempo targets that suit your current level. As endurance and speed improve, progressively shorten rest to challenge your lactate tolerance while maintaining technique under fatigue. Document perceived exertion alongside objective data so you can adjust plans without sacrificing form. The goal is a balanced program where consistency in mechanics under pressure becomes the norm, translating to consistent open-water results across different venues.
Finally, embed recovery and adaptation into the schedule to sustain long-term gains. Schedule at least one easy day between intense sessions and prioritize sleep, nutrition, and mobility work. Do targeted stretches for the shoulders, thoracic spine, hips, and ankles to preserve range of motion and alignment. Implement self-myofascial release on tight areas, especially after back-to-back high-intensity sets. Periodize cycles to peak for major races while allowing sufficient adaptation time. With thoughtful recovery, the interval progression remains sustainable, and swimmers carry speed and control into every open-water event with greater confidence and fewer excuses.
